When I started the practicum, I didn't have much money, so I bought a cheap iWork set. The case broke the first time I opened it, the precision driver was crooked, the spin cap had a lot of resistance, and would get caught, and the ratcheting handle was really sloppy and skipped. After that day, I decided to get good tools, even If I had to pay more. The iFixit isn't that expensive and it's quite good. Some screw extraction pliers and an esd mat are a good addition.

Dude, use the ESD strap and keep your hands off the contacts. A good chunk of CMOS ICs will blow with improper handling, and no ESD strap or mat is improper handling. Otherwise good video.
